Harvard found that people who used just over half a tablespoon a day died early far less often, and Cleveland Clinic explains why: antioxidants, anti-inflammatory compounds and heart-friendly fat.</h2><ol class="aa-list"><li><span class="aa-n">1</span><span><span class="aa-food">More than 7 grams</span> · about half a tablespoon a day, the amount Harvard tied to a lower risk of dying</span></li><li><span class="aa-n">2</span><span><span class="aa-food">19 percent</span> · lower risk of dying from heart disease in the highest olive oil group</span></li><li><span class="aa-n">3</span><span><span class="aa-food">20-plus polyphenols</span> · the antioxidants in extra virgin olive oil that fight inflammation</span></li><li><span class="aa-n">4</span><span><span class="aa-food">About 73 percent</span> · how much of olive oil is oleic acid, the heart-healthy main fat</span></li><li><span class="aa-n">5</span><span><span class="aa-food">Swap, do not add</span> · the benefit shows up when oil replaces butter, not when it tops junk food</span></li></ol><div class="aa-cue"><a class="aa-cta" href="#coach-recommendations">Get Your Coach's 3-Step Plan <span class="aa-arw">↓</span></a></div></div><p>Olive oil gets treated like a luxury: something you drizzle for flavor and feel vaguely virtuous about. The research treats it more like a daily habit worth keeping, and it is specific about how much and why.</p><p><a href="https://hsph.harvard.edu/news/higher-olive-oil-consumption-linked-with-lower-risk-of-premature-death"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Harvard T.H. Chan School of Public Health</a> followed more than 90,000 U.S. adults for 28 years and found that people in the highest category of olive oil use, more than seven grams a day, which is a little over half a tablespoon, had a 19 percent lower risk of dying from cardiovascular disease and a 17 percent lower risk of dying from cancer than people who almost never used it.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> explains the machinery behind numbers like those.</p><div class="ac-band"><div class="inner"><div class="big">1</div><div><div class="q">The mechanism</div><h3>Why Extra Virgin Is the One That Matters</h3></div></div></div><p>Not all olive oil is equal.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> explains there are three grades, refined, virgin and extra virgin, and that extra virgin, the least processed, is highest in antioxidants because it is not altered by heat or chemicals. Its dietitian calls extra virgin the far superior oil, and a staple of the Mediterranean diet.</p><p>The reason is a group of compounds called polyphenols.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> notes that extra virgin olive oil contains more than 20 types of polyphenols, plant antioxidants that help protect your heart and reduce inflammation throughout your body by neutralizing the unstable molecules, called free radicals, that drive oxidative stress and chronic disease.</p><div class="ac-band hype"><div class="inner"><div class="big">2</div><div><div class="q">The anti-inflammatory part</div><h3>The Compound Compared to Ibuprofen</h3></div></div></div><p>One antioxidant stands out.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> reports that oleocanthal, a main antioxidant in virgin and extra virgin olive oil, has anti-inflammatory properties strong enough that researchers have compared it to ibuprofen, and that oleic acid, the main fatty acid, has also been shown to reduce inflammation.</p><p>That matters because inflammation is not just what you see around a cut.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> explains it can happen quietly inside the body and wear on your health over time. The same oleocanthal is also being studied for a role in the death of cancer cells, though <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> is careful to say olive oil is not a magic pill and that nothing is.</p><figure class="ac-figure"><img src="https://images.pexels.com/photos/25745497/pexels-photo-25745497.jpeg?auto=compress&cs=tinysrgb&w=800&h=300&fit=crop" alt="An overhead view of a glass cruet of golden olive oil beside fresh olives and olive leaves on a wooden board" width="800" height="300" loading="lazy" decoding="async"><figcaption>Cleveland Clinic says extra virgin olive oil, the least processed grade, is highest in the antioxidants that do the work.</figcaption></figure><div class="ac-band"><div class="inner"><div class="big">3</div><div><div class="q">The heart case</div><h3>What It Does for Your Heart</h3></div></div></div><p>The cardiovascular story is the best documented.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> says olive oil has been shown to reduce lipids and blood pressure, and points to a 2017 study finding the polyphenols in extra virgin olive oil help protect against atherosclerosis, the hardening of the arteries, as well as stroke and cardiovascular disease.</p><p>The fat itself does work too.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> notes that oleic acid makes up about 73 percent of olive oil and is a monounsaturated fat shown to lower bad LDL cholesterol, raise good HDL and reduce the risk of heart disease and stroke, while a compound called oleuropein helps lower blood pressure and protects LDL from oxidation.</p><div class="ac-band"><div class="inner"><div class="big">4</div><div><div class="q">The long game</div><h3>The 28-Year Longevity Signal</h3></div></div></div><p>Zoom out to a lifetime and the pattern holds. <a href="https://hsph.harvard.edu/news/higher-olive-oil-consumption-linked-with-lower-risk-of-premature-death"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Harvard</a> reports that in the highest olive oil group, the 19 percent lower risk of dying reached across causes: 17 percent lower cancer mortality, 29 percent lower death from neurodegenerative disease and 18 percent lower respiratory mortality, compared with people who rarely used it.</p><p><a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> frames the same 2022 study plainly: over 28 years, high olive oil consumption was associated with an 8 to 34 percent lower risk of death related to disease. These are associations from observational research, not a guarantee, but they are large and they line up with the biology.</p><div class="ac-callout"><div class="n">People who used more than seven grams of olive oil a day, a little over half a tablespoon, had a 19 percent lower risk of dying from cardiovascular disease.</div><div class="d">That is the finding from a Harvard study that followed more than 90,000 U.S. adults for 28 years, and swapping butter or margarine for olive oil is what drove it.</div><div class="c">Harvard T.H. Chan School of Public Health</div></div><div class="ac-band"><div class="inner"><div class="big">5</div><div><div class="q">How to use it</div><h3>The Catch: Swap, Do Not Add</h3></div></div></div><p>Here is the part most people miss.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> is emphatic that you only reap the benefits of olive oil when you use it in place of less healthy fats, not on top of them. Its dietitian puts it bluntly: you cannot add it to a diet of fried and junk food and expect results. Olive oil should be the primary fat in your diet, followed by nuts.</p><p>In practice that means simple swaps. <a href="https://health.clevelandclinic.org/benefits-of-olive-oil"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cleveland Clinic</a> suggests using extra virgin olive oil instead of butter, mayo or seed oils, drizzling it on salads in place of dressing, and adding it to cooked vegetables or pasta. <a href="https://hsph.harvard.edu/news/higher-olive-oil-consumption-linked-with-lower-risk-of-premature-death"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Harvard</a> found the clearest benefit exactly when olive oil replaced margarine, butter, mayonnaise or dairy fat. LIVE LONG.</text></svg></div><div class="ac-faq"><h2>Frequently Asked Questions</h2><details><summary>How much olive oil should I use a day?</summary><div class="a">Cleveland Clinic recommends 1 to 4 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il a day, adjusted for your age, weight, activity and calorie needs. Harvard's study tied benefits to as little as more than seven grams a day, a little over half a tablespoon.</div></details><details><summary>Is extra virgin really better than regular olive oil?</summary><div class="a">Yes, for the health compounds. Cleveland Clinic says extra virgin is the least processed grade and highest in antioxidants because it is not altered by heat or chemicals. Refined and light olive oils have a milder taste but fewer antioxidants.</div></details><details><summary>Does olive oil actually help you live longer?</summary><div class="a">The research is associational but strong. Harvard T.H. Chan School followed more than 90,000 U.S. adults for 28 years and found the highest olive oil users had a 19 percent lower risk of dying from cardiovascular disease, and lower risk from cancer, neurodegenerative and respiratory disease. It is a link, not a guarantee.</div></details><details><summary>Do I get the benefit if I just add olive oil to my meals?</summary><div class="a">Not really. Cleveland Clinic is clear that the benefit comes from using olive oil in place of less healthy fats like butter and mayo, not adding it on top of fried or junk food. Harvard found the clearest benefit when olive oil replaced butter, margarine, mayonnaise or dairy fat.</div></details><details><summary>Can I cook with extra virgin olive oil?</summary><div class="a">Yes. Cleveland Clinic suggests using it in place of seed oils and animal fats, drizzling it on salads, and adding it to cooked vegetables or pasta. You can bake with it too, though some find the flavor strong for desserts.</div></details><details><summary>Is this medical advice?</summary><div class="a">No. This article is educational and is not a substitute for advice from your doctor. Olive oil is food, not medicine, and works as part of an overall healthy diet.
